Pay Information $47 per hour About The Position Summary: Ref : C-RN-8911678 Profession: Registered Nurse Job Type: Contract/Non-Travel Location: Philadelphia, PA Start Date: ASAP Duration: 13 weeks Schedule: Sun, Mon, Fri, Sat, 03:00 PM-11:30 PM Rate: Local: $755/16-hours Requirements: Valid and active Registered Nurse State license BLS certification Responsibilities: Plan and implement nursing care, administer medication, and obtain specimens for testing. Collaborate in multidisciplinary treatment, assist with procedures, and prepare records. Provide ongoing patient assessments, interventions, and record progress. Document all nursing activities in medical records, including assessments and education. Ensure a safe therapeutic environment, maintain order, and supervise patient conduct.
